Player Overview

Cau Van Nguyen, a Vietnamese-American poker player, currently ranked #16831 in the world, with lifetime career earnings of $202,910. He is primarily active in live tournaments and has achieved cashes in events such as the WSOP.

Career and Major Results

Cau Van Nguyen's poker career began with small online stakes and gradually transitioned to live events. He has cashed multiple times in WSOP series events, with his best result being a top-six finish in a low buy-in side event. Additionally, he has made several final tables in other regional tournaments, accumulating over $200,000 in total earnings.
